Complete inspection history

2 inspections
PassLatest Mar 30, 2026
86/100

ROUTINE INSPECTION

6 reported violations
  • K44: Premises clean, in good repair; Personal/chemical storage; Adequate vermin-proofing

    Front and back door left open. [CA] Keep doors closed at all times to prevent entrance of leaves, debris, flies, other vermin etc. Recommend to install a screen door in the back if approved by fire dept and city of palo alto. REPEAT VIOLATION.

  • K06: Adequate handwash facilities supplied, accessible

    Hand sink in the front was blocked with brooms/dust pan. Lack of paper towels at back hand sink. [CA] Keep hand sink unobstructed at all times, relocate brooms near mop sink. Keep dispensers stocked at all times. [COS]

  • K23: No rodents, insects, birds, or animals

    Observed 2 house flies in facility. [CA] Eliminate the flies.

  • K33: Nonfood contact surfaces clean

    Observed shelving between the prep unit and oven in the front area with build up of food debris. [CA] Clean/sanitize this area.

  • K35: Equipment, utensils: Approved, in good repair, adequate capacity

    The middle door of the 3 door unit in the back is unable to fully self close. The door hinge appears to be inoperable. [CA] Keep in good repair, recommend to tighten the door hinge.

  • K39: Thermometers provided, accurate

    Lack of thermometer at sandwich prep unit and 1 door cheese unit in the back. [CA] Provide thermometers.

Pass Mar 3, 2025
93/100

ROUTINE INSPECTION

3 reported violations
  • K06: Adequate handwash facilities supplied, accessible

    Observed both hand sinks blocked by box of paper supplies and laundry basked. [CA] Hand sink shall be unobstructed at all times. [COS]

  • K44: Premises clean, in good repair; Personal/chemical storage; Adequate vermin-proofing

    Observed front door left open. Leaves and debris noted on floors. [CA] Keep door closed at all times to prevent outside contaminants and vermin from entering facility.

  • K40: Wiping cloths: properly used, stored

    Observed several wiping cloths on counters. [CA] When cloths are used more than once, store in a sanitizing solution between uses.
